2013 Bindi Kostas Rind Chardonnay
(Updated: June 28, 2016)
Wine Rating
96
This wine has a structure and elegance that sets it apart from other wines, it has all the elements of a great Chardonnay, attractive stone fruits, piercing citrus acidity and complex winemaker inputs, but in particular it’s the seamless integration across the palate that is it's greatest attribute.
Wet stone, savoury edged fig, peach skins and nectarine on the nose, the palate has a baseline of citrus with white peach and wood induced spice; layered but restrained leesy richness gives a textured and full mouthfeel.
This wine will cellar well for the medium term and is in a great place now.
